Ingredients

To create the scrumptious Peach Pie Cruffins, you will need:

  • 3 cans (8 ounces each) of refrigerated crescent roll dough, which transforms into a crispy, golden exterior.
  • 1 cup of peach preserves or peach jam, bursting with juicy sweetness that evokes the taste of summer.
  • 1 teaspoon of ground cinnamon, adding aromatic warmth to this delightful dish.
  • 1/2 cup of powdered sugar, providing the sweetness necessary to elevate the glaze.
  • 3 tablespoons of heavy whipping cream, ensuring a creamy consistency for your perfect drizzle.

With these simple yet flavorful ingredients, you’re well on your way to creating an unforgettable treat!

Step-by-Step Directions

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and prepare a 12-cup muffin tin, ensuring it’s well-greased to facilitate easy removal.

  2. In a small bowl, combine the peach preserves and ground cinnamon, stirring until thoroughly mixed to a delightful, aromatic blend.

  3. Unroll one can of crescent dough and press the seams together to form a single rectangle, paving the way for your delicious filling.

  4. Spread 1/3 cup of the peach-cinnamon mixture over the dough, making sure to leave a small border around the edges for easy rolling.

  5. Roll the dough tightly into a log, taking care to encompass the delicious filling, then cut the log in half before slicing each piece lengthwise.

  6. Twist each strip gently to give a lovely spiral look and place them into the muffin tin with the swirl facing upwards, creating an enticing visual for your cruffins.

  7. Repeat the process with the remaining dough and filling until all muffin cups are filled, filling your kitchen with a mouthwatering aroma.

  8. Bake for 18-20 minutes, or until the cruffins are golden brown and your home is filled with warm, inviting scents.

  9. While your cruffins are baking, whisk together powdered sugar and heavy cream until smooth for the perfect glaze that will add a sweet finishing touch.

  10. Let the cruffins cool for about 5 minutes before drizzling them generously with the glaze. Enjoy them warm for a delightful experience!

Tips & Tricks

To enhance your Peach Pie Cruffins further, consider the following tips:

  • Allow the peach preserves to come to room temperature before mixing; this will make them easier to spread.
  • For added texture, sprinkle a few chopped pecans or walnuts into the peach filling.
  • Experiment with spices by adding a pinch of nutmeg or ginger for a unique flavor twist.
  • If you’re feeling adventurous, try substituting the peach preserves with other fruity options like apricot or raspberry for a different taste experience.

Storing Tips & Variations

To keep your Peach Pie Cruffins fresh,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days. For longer storage, you can freeze them, ensuring they are well-wrapped in plastic wrap or foil to prevent freezer burn. When ready to enjoy, simply thaw at room temperature and re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 5-10 minutes to regain their flaky texture.

For variations, consider filling your cruffins with different fruits or a combination of fillings. Blueberry, cherry, or mixed berry preserves can add exciting new flavors. You could also switch up the glaze by incorporating a flavored syrup or zesting some lemon or orange for a fresh twist.

FAQs

  1. Can I use fresh peaches instead of preserves?
    Yes, you can use fresh peaches, but they will need to be cooked down with sugar and spices first to create a filling similar to the preserves.

  2. How can I make these cruffins healthier?
    Consider using a whole wheat crescent roll dough or reducing the amount of sugar in the glaze to make a healthier version.

  3. Can I prepare these in advance?
    Absolutely! You can prepare the dough and filling the night before, assemble them, and store them in the fridge overnight. Bake in the morning for fresh cruffins!

  4. What should I do if my dough doesn’t unroll easily?
    If your dough is stuck, let it sit at room temperature for a few minutes. This usually helps soften the dough and makes unrolling easier.

  5. Can I scale this recipe for a larger crowd?
    Yes! Simply double or triple the ingredients, and adjust your baking times as needed for larger batches. Just ensure you have enough muffin tins or bake in multiple batches.
